
SAN FRANCISCO, CA, November 4, 2013 – Union Bank, N.A. today announced that Matthew Townsend has joined its Retail Consumer Lending team as a senior mortgage consultant in the East Bay. Based in Union Bank’s Orinda and Moraga branches, Townsend is responsible for assisting clients with their home mortgage needs in the East Bay area. Union Bank’s Consumer Lending group originates residential mortgage options to answer a variety of financing needs. Townsend reports to Vice President and Regional Sales Manager Susan McLaughlin.
“With 11 years of mortgage industry experience and a dedication to fostering client relationships, we are pleased to have Matthew join our Consumer Lending group,” said McLaughlin. “Matthew brings a strong focus on customer service and lending expertise to our team that will help us further meet the needs of our clients looking to purchase or refinance a home in the East Bay.”

Before joining Union Bank, Townsend served as a senior mortgage loan officer with Bank of America. Active in the community, he volunteers with Habitat for Humanity and local Little League and soccer teams. Townsend holds a bachelor’s degree from Sacramento State University.

About UnionBanCal Corporation & Union Bank, N.A.
Headquartered in San Francisco, UnionBanCal Corporation is a financial holding company with assets of $105.5 billion at September 30, 2013. Its primary subsidiary, Union Bank, N.A., provides an array of financial services to individuals, small businesses, middle-market companies, and major corporations. The bank operated 422 branches in California, Washington, Oregon, Texas, Illinois, and New York as well as two international offices, on September 30, 2013. UnionBanCal Corporation is a wholly-owned subsidiary of The Bank of Tokyo-Mitsubishi UFJ, Ltd., which is a subsidiary of Mitsubishi UFJ Financial Group, Inc. Union Bank is a proud member of the Mitsubishi UFJ Financial Group (MUFG, NYSE:MTU), one of the world’s largest financial organizations.
